Transaction 64e92ab73c2c9effb76eca50751e2bcf63eac8d78962bdda9003fc893200f361
1 Input
1 Output
-
64e92ab73c2c9effb76eca50751e2bcf63eac8d78962bdda9003fc893200f361:0
- value
- 290566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08fe4ba9aee1063c3410dbff502beae99e313f59 OP_EQUAL
- address
- 32WZxqsqYYRmZx28uYkiY6tY6P5qy85HW1